Kevin Fenlon, who has worked for Worcester State for the past 16 years, took on this new role and now oversees the staff and operation of the <a href=\"https:\/\/www.worcester.edu\/campus-life\/counseling-services\/\">Counseling Center<\/a>. Recently promoted after the long-time Associate Dean\/Director of Counseling Services, Laurie Murphy, retired in August of 2024, Kevin has jumped right into the position and has already gained valuable insight on what it takes to be a leader for his team.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><!--more--><\/p>\n<div id=\"attachment_6979\" style=\"width: 387px\" class=\"wp-caption alignright\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" aria-describedby=\"caption-attachment-6979\" class=\"wp-image-6979 size-full\" src=\"https:\/\/www.worcester.edu\/campus-life\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/56\/2024\/11\/43e8514e-0bed-11ee-ac7f-0a58a9feac02.jpg\" alt=\"\" width=\"377\" height=\"640\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.worcester.edu\/campus-life\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/56\/2024\/11\/43e8514e-0bed-11ee-ac7f-0a58a9feac02.jpg 377w, https:\/\/www.worcester.edu\/campus-life\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/56\/2024\/11\/43e8514e-0bed-11ee-ac7f-0a58a9feac02-177x300.jpg 177w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 377px) 100vw, 377px\" \/><p id=\"caption-attachment-6979\" class=\"wp-caption-text\">Kevin &amp; MK at a Red Sox Game<\/p><\/div>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400\">Kevin, who resides in Holden, MA, with his wife and four sons, received his Bachelor\u2019s degree in Psychology and a Master\u2019s degree in Counseling Psychology with a concentration in Cognitive Behavioral Therapy for Adults, both from Assumption University in Worcester. Previously employed as the <\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400\">Clinical Director of New River Academy, a 90-day Department of Youth Services treatment facility for adolescents, Kevin joined Worcester State in 2008 as the Assistant Director in the Counseling Center and moved into the Associate Director role in 2022. Although still a practicing therapist within the office, Kevin oversees a staff of five counselors and one support staff in his new role. He is also a valuable member of the WSU Care Team, a collaborative group that promotes student well-being through proactive, compassionate, and transparent assistance through cross-campus supportive measures. Kevin also serves as an adjunct professor in the Psychology Department.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400\">Although he is a leader within his office, Kevin identifies first and foremost as a therapist. He finds that his most meaningful exchanges with students are in individual sessions when the student is comfortable enough to open up. This vulnerability leads to greater self-awareness and a readiness to overcome challenges and work through trauma. Working with a student to reach that level is fulfilling and why Kevin does what he does every day.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400\">One of Kevin\u2019s favorite aspects of his position is working with his NEADS assistance dog, MK. MK resides with Kevin in the Counseling Center and when MK is not working at WSU, he serves as the Fenlon family dog. <a href=\"https:\/\/neads.org\/\">NEADS<\/a> is a national service and assistance dog breeding and training organization in Princeton, MA which has raised and trained more than 1900 dogs since 1976. MK joins Kevin in counseling sessions with students, classroom visits, and at events such as Fresh Check Day and New Student Orientation. In his new role, Kevin has adjusted his style to be more directive and vocal in working with his staff and colleagues across campus.\u00a0\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400\">Kevin has learned many leadership lessons during his career. \u201cDoing what you say you are going to do is important for any leader.\u201d Setting boundaries and limits with students and colleagues is also valuable in leading on a college campus. Another important lesson learned is dealing with conflict. \u201cLearning to be okay with conflict is important. Sometimes you have to go backward to move forward as a unit. You can\u2019t take any conflict personally.\u201d<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400\">Kevin\u2019s definition of a leader includes a high standard of achievement and the willingness to continue to learn and grow. Kevin believes that a great leader will continue to attempt to master whatever field they are in and should contest the notion of an \u2018expert\u2019. Continuous growth is crucial to improve skills as a leader and active listening is also crucial for building mutual respect within a team.
